diff options
Diffstat (limited to '')
| -rw-r--r-- | cmd/mpd-scrobbler/main.go | 5 | ||||
| -rw-r--r-- | internal/scrobbler/db.go | 1 |
2 files changed, 4 insertions, 2 deletions
diff --git a/cmd/mpd-scrobbler/main.go b/cmd/mpd-scrobbler/main.go index cce441d..30c3e5c 100644 --- a/cmd/mpd-scrobbler/main.go +++ b/cmd/mpd-scrobbler/main.go @@ -44,7 +44,10 @@ func main() { } }() - s.Run() + err = s.Run() + if err != nil { + log.Fatalf("failed to run the scrobbler: %v", err) + } } func getDbPath() (string, error) { diff --git a/internal/scrobbler/db.go b/internal/scrobbler/db.go index 5f80aa4..7b97b82 100644 --- a/internal/scrobbler/db.go +++ b/internal/scrobbler/db.go @@ -39,7 +39,6 @@ func initdb(dbpath string) error { func opendatabase(dbpath string) (*sql.DB, error) { var err error _, err = os.Stat(dbpath) - if err != nil { if err := initdb(dbpath); err != nil { return nil, err |
